1#!/bin/sh -
2
3random_uniform() {
4	local	_upper_bound
5
6	if [[ $1 -gt 0 ]]; then
7		_upper_bound=$(($1 - 1))
8	else
9		_upper_bound=0
10	fi
11
12	echo `jot -r 1 0 $_upper_bound 2>/dev/null`
13}
14
15umask 007
16
17PAGE_SIZE=`sysctl -n hw.pagesize`
18PAD=$1
19GAPDUMMY=$2
20
21RANDOM1=`random_uniform $((3 * PAGE_SIZE))`
22RANDOM2=`random_uniform $PAGE_SIZE`
23RANDOM3=`random_uniform $PAGE_SIZE`
24RANDOM4=`random_uniform $PAGE_SIZE`
25RANDOM5=`random_uniform $PAGE_SIZE`
26
27cat > gap.link << __EOF__
28
29PHDRS {
30	text PT_LOAD FILEHDR PHDRS;
31	rodata PT_LOAD;
32	data PT_LOAD;
33	bss PT_LOAD;
34}
35
36SECTIONS {
37	.text : ALIGN($PAGE_SIZE) {
38		LONG($PAD);
39		. += $RANDOM1;
40		. = ALIGN($PAGE_SIZE);
41		endboot = .;
42		PROVIDE (endboot = .);
43		. = ALIGN($PAGE_SIZE);
44		. += $RANDOM2;
45		. = ALIGN(16);
46		*(.text .text.*)
47	} :text =$PAD
48
49	.rodata : {
50		LONG($PAD);
51		. += $RANDOM3;
52		. = ALIGN(16);
53		*(.rodata .rodata.*)
54	} :rodata =$PAD
55
56	.data : {
57		LONG($PAD);
58		. = . + $RANDOM4;	/* fragment of page */
59		. = ALIGN(16);
60		*(.data .data.*)
61	} :data =$PAD
62
63	.bss : {
64		. = . + $RANDOM5;	/* fragment of page */
65		. = ALIGN(16);
66		*(.bss .bss.*)
67	} :bss
68}
69__EOF__
70
71$LD $LDFLAGS -r gap.link $GAPDUMMY -o gap.o
